{{tag>Karmic navigateur enlightenment}}
----
====== Eve ======
[[http://trac.enlightenment.org/e/wiki/Eve|Eve]] est un navigateur web en cours de développement pour e17, basé sur les EFL et Webkit. Pour consulter des information à ce propos, vous pouvez vous référer au [[http://tonikitoo.blogspot.com/|blog du développeur de Eve]], ou encore consulter la page du [[http://trac.webkit.org/wiki/EFLWebKit|wiki de EFLWebkit]].
===== Pré-requis =====
Pour installer Eve, il est nécessaire d'avoir [[installation_e17_sources|installé e17 par svn]] et non par les dépôts. Notez cependant qu'avec [[:enlightenment#elive_basee_sur_debian|Elive]], vous pouvez installer Eve tout simplement avec synaptic.
{{ http://pagesperso-orange.fr/dazibaldo/Pics/eve.png?250}}
Tout d'abord, [[:tutoriel:comment_installer_un_paquet|installez les dépendances]] :
[[apt://autoconf|autoconf]], [[apt://automake|automake]], [[apt://libtool|libtool]], [[apt://libgtk2.0-dev|libgtk2.0-dev]], [[apt://libpango1.0-dev|libpango1.0-dev]], [[apt://libicu-dev|libicu-dev]], [[apt://libxslt-dev|libxslt-dev]], [[apt://libsoup2.4-dev|libsoup2.4-dev]], [[apt://libsqlite3-dev|libsqlite3-dev]], [[apt://gperf|gperf]], [[apt://bison|bison]], [[apt://flex|flex]], [[apt://libjpeg62-dev|libjpeg62-dev]], [[apt://libpng12-dev|libpng12-dev]], [[apt://libxt-dev|libxt-dev]], [[apt://autotools-dev|autotools-dev]], [[apt://libgstreamer-plugins-base0.10-dev|libgstreamer-plugins-base0.10-dev]], [[apt://libenchant-dev|libenchant-dev]], [[apt://libgail-dev|libgail-dev]], [[apt://git-core|git-core]], [[apt://libenchant-dev|libenchant-dev]], [[apt://libsoup2.4-dev|libsoup2.4-dev]]
^ Installer en 1 clic |
| [[apt://autoconf,automake,libtool,libgtk2.0-dev,libpango1.0-dev,libicu-dev,libxslt-dev,libsoup2.4-dev,libsqlite3-dev,gperf,bison,flex,libjpeg62-dev,libpng12-dev,libxt-dev,autotools-dev,libgstreamer-plugins-base0.10-dev,libenchant-dev,libgail-devgit-core,libenchant-dev,libsoup2.4-dev|{{ apt.png }}]]|
Installer la version de développement de WebKit :
git clone git://code.staikos.net/webkit webkit
cd ~/webkit
git checkout origin/master
git checkout -b webkit-efl-0.1
./autogen.sh --with-port=efl --disable-video
sudo make all install
sudo ldconfig
**
Ce qui précède est obsolète, voir plutôt ici : http://trac.webkit.org/wiki/EFLWebKit**
===== Installation =====
Dans un terminal, utilisez la commande « ''cd'' » pour aller dans le répertoire contenant la version svn de e17. Dirigez vous dans le "''trunk''" pour aller dans "''PROTO''" puis dans "''eve''".
Pour trouver cet emplacement, tapez « ''locate PROTO'' » dans un [[terminal]], ou bien référez vous au site suivant : [[http://trac.enlightenment.org/e/browser/trunk/PROTO/eve]|tracker du site d'Enlightenment]].
Lancez la compilation des sources :
./autogen.sh && make
Puis, au choix, pour installer les binaires :
* avec make sudo make install
* avec checkinstall, pour créer un paquet désinstallable depuis votre gestionnaire de paquet sudo checkinstall
===== Configuration =====
à terminer
===== Utilisation =====
===== Désinstallation =====
==== Si vous avez installé Eve par make ====
Depuis le dossier des source de **eve**, tapez :
sudo make uninstall
==== Si vous avez installé Eve par checkinstall ou depuis les dépôts ====
Il suffit de [[:tutoriel:comment_supprimer_un_paquet|supprimer le paquet]] **eve**. La configuration de l'application sera conservée ou supprimée selon la méthode de désinstallation que vous choisirez.
===== Liens =====
[[http://trac.webkit.org/wiki/EFLWebKit|méthode d'installation pour webkit-efl]]\\
[[http://trac.webkit.org/wiki/BuildingQtOnLinux|méthode d'installation pour le port qt]]\\
[[http://trac.webkit.org/wiki/BuildingGtk|méthode d'installation pour le port gtk]]\\
[[http://trac.webkit.org/wiki/BuildingGtk|méthode d'installation pour le port gtk]]\\
[[http://webkit.org/|site de webkit]]\\
----
//Contributeurs principaux : mondai//